1. Drip Coffee Maker
Drip coffee machine stay popular due to their simplicity and the capability to brew several cups. Suitable for families or families with high coffee usage, they typically include programmable settings, making it possible for users to awaken to freshly brewed coffee.
2. French Press
The French press is a favorite amongst coffee fanatics for its capability to produce a full-bodied brew. Users merely add coarse coffee grounds to the vessel, put in warm water, and let it high before pushing down the plunger. This approach enhances the coffee's natural oils, resulting in an abundant taste profile.
3. Espresso Machines
Espresso machines cater to those who value high-strength coffee drinks. They permit users to create espresso shots, lattes, and coffees, opening up a world of coffee possibilities. However, they normally require more knowledge and practice to master.
4. Single Serve Coffee Makers
For those who are constantly on the go, single-serve machines provide a wonderful choice. They use pre-packaged coffee pods to brew quick cups of coffee, making them a popular option for busy individuals or those who consume coffee infrequently.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: How do I clean my coffee maker?
It's vital to clean your coffee machine frequently to ensure optimal efficiency and taste. Many drip coffee machine can be cleaned by running an option of equal parts water and vinegar through the machine, followed by a number of cycles of fresh water. For French presses, simply wash the plunger and glass with warm water and mild cleaning agent.
Q2: What kind of coffee grounds should I utilize?
The type of coffee grounds depends on the coffee maker in usage. Fine grounds appropriate for espresso machines, while coarser grounds work much better with French presses. For drip coffee makers, medium grind coffee is preferred.
Q3: Can I utilize regular coffee beans for my espresso machine?
Yes, you can use routine coffee beans in an espresso machine; however, it's advised to use espresso-specific beans for a more authentic flavor and experience.
Q4: How much caffeine is in a cup of coffee brewed from a coffee maker?
The amount of caffeine can differ based on the type of coffee, the developing approach, and the quantity used. Typically, an 8-ounce cup brewed in a coffee maker includes about 95 mg of caffeine.
